A syrupy, decadent nutty gourmand that wraps you in layers of almond, pistachio and orange blossom. Girl of Now is unapologetically sweet, rich, and comforting, perfect for colder days or whenever you want to be noticed.
This one's a proper ride-or-die. You'll either fall head over heels for its creamy, nutty sweetness or find it utterly repulsive. Don't blind buy, test it first - especially if you're not into intense, powdery almond-rose vibes.

Seasons
The dense, sweet, nutty and creamy accords thrive in cooler weather, perfect for fall and especially winter, where the syrupy almond and pistachio feel comforting and enveloping. Spring is possible with light application, but the heavy sweetness can be cloying in heat.
Occasions
This is a statement scent with strong projection and longevity, making it ideal for date nights or casual outings where you want to stand out and feel cozy. It can be overwhelming in professional or sporty settings due to its bold, gourmand sweetness.
